这是两种不同的硬盘分区计数方式
grub:grub中不管是SATA还是IDE的都用hd表示(不好意思写顺手了,忘记了。谢谢4楼提醒)
1.硬盘的块数即您有多少块硬盘,那么硬盘编号就从hd0,hd1,hd2,……一直继续下去
2.一块硬盘仅能分四个主分区。那么这四个主分区就占用四个分区名,
比如第一块硬盘:(hd0,0),(hd0,1),(hd0,2),(hd0,3)
剩余的分区就是逻辑分区,按照顺序编号
dev:
1.sd指的是SATA硬盘,hd指的是IDE硬盘,如hd0,sd1。以为sd为例,hd相当
2.硬盘的块数用sda,sdb,sdc……继续下去,超过26个硬盘就是sdaa,sdab,sdac,……继续下去
3.一块硬盘仅能分四个主分区。那么这四个主分区就占用四个分区名,
比如第一块硬盘:sda1,sda2,sda3,sda4
剩余的分区就是逻辑分区,按照顺序编号
另外,主分区即使没有分到4个,但是分区号仍然保留

貌似对于grub来说,硬盘都是用hd表示的,磁盘序号和分区号都是从0开始计算的。而对于Linux(内核)来说,IDE硬盘是用hd表示的,SATA硬盘是用sd表示的,磁盘序号是从a开始计算的,分区号是从1开始计算的。

2 Naming convention
*******************
The device syntax used in GRUB is a wee bit different from what you may
have seen before in your operating system(s), and you need to know it so
that you can specify a drive/partition.
Look at the following examples and explanations:
(fd0)
First of all, GRUB requires that the device name be enclosed with
`(' and `)'. The `fd' part means that it is a floppy disk. The number
`0' is the drive number, which is counted from _zero_. This expression
means that GRUB will use the whole floppy disk.
(hd0,1)
Here, `hd' means it is a hard disk drive. The first integer `0'
indicates the drive number, that is, the first hard disk, while the
second integer, `1', indicates the partition number (or the PC slice
number in the BSD terminology). Once again, please note that the
partition numbers are counted from _zero_, not from one. This
expression means the second partition of the first hard disk drive. In
this case, GRUB uses one partition of the disk, instead of the whole
disk.
(hd0,4)
This specifies the first "extended partition" of the first hard disk
drive. Note that the partition numbers for extended partitions are
counted from `4', regardless of the actual number of primary partitions
on your hard disk.
(hd1,a)
This means the BSD `a' partition of the second hard disk. If you
need to specify which PC slice number should be used, use something
like this: `(hd1,0,a)'. If the PC slice number is omitted, GRUB
searches for the first PC slice which has a BSD `a' partition.
Of course, to actually access the disks or partitions with GRUB, you
need to use the device specification in a command, like `root (fd0)' or
`unhide (hd0,2)'. To help you find out which number specifies a
partition you want, the GRUB command-line (*note Command-line
interface::) options have argument completion. This means that, for
example, you only need to type
root (
followed by a <TAB>, and GRUB will display the list of drives,
partitions, or file names. So it should be quite easy to determine the
name of your target partition, even with minimal knowledge of the
syntax.
Note that GRUB does _not_ distinguish IDE from SCSI - it simply
counts the drive numbers from zero, regardless of their type. Normally,
any IDE drive number is less than any SCSI drive number, although that
is not true if you change the boot sequence by swapping IDE and SCSI
drives in your BIOS.
Now the question is, how to specify a file? Again, consider an
example:
(hd0,0)/vmlinuz
This specifies the file named `vmlinuz', found on the first
partition of the first hard disk drive. Note that the argument
completion works with file names, too.
That was easy, admit it. Now read the next chapter, to find out how
to actually install GRUB on your drive.
